ফ্রিল্যান্সিং জগতে আমার সবচেয়ে পছন্দনীয় সেক্টর
ভুমিকা
প্রযুক্তির প্রসার এবং ডিজিটালাইজেশনের মাধ্যমে ফ্রিল্যান্সিং এখন বৈশ্বিক
কর্মজীবনের গুরুত্বপূর্ণ অংশে পরিণত হয়েছে। মানুষ ঘরে বসে স্বাধীনভাবে কাজ করতে
পারে এবং বিভিন্ন দেশে থাকা ক্লায়েন্টদের জন্য সেবা দিতে পারে। ফ্রিল্যান্সিংয়ের
অনেকগুলো সেক্টরের মধ্যে, আমার জন্য সবচেয়ে আকর্ষণীয় হলো ওয়েব ডেভেলপমেন্ট।
এই সেক্টরে কাজের সুযোগ, সৃজনশীলতা এবং চ্যালেঞ্জিং প্রকৃতি আমাকে সবসময়
অনুপ্রাণিত করে। এই আর্টিকেলে আমি ওয়েব ডেভেলপমেন্ট সেক্টর সম্পর্কে বিস্তারিত
আলোচনা করব, কেন এটি আমার পছন্দ, এবং কীভাবে এটি ফ্রিল্যান্সিং ক্যারিয়ার গঠনে
সহায়ক হতে পারে।
পেজ সূচিপত্রঃ ওয়েব ডেভেলপমেন্ট সম্পর্কে বিস্তারিত আলোচনা
ওয়েব ডেভেলপমেন্ট বলতে মূলত ওয়েবসাইট বা ওয়েব অ্যাপ্লিকেশন তৈরি, উন্নয়ন এবং
রক্ষণাবেক্ষণের পুরো প্রক্রিয়াকে বোঝায়। এটি মূলত দুটি প্রধান ভাগে বিভক্ত:
১. ফ্রন্টএন্ড ডেভেলপমেন্টঃ
ফ্রন্টএন্ড হলো ওয়েবসাইটের দৃশ্যমান অংশ, যেটি ব্যবহারকারী সরাসরি দেখে এবং এর
সাথে ইন্টারঅ্যাক্ট করে। HTML, CSS, এবং JavaScript ব্যবহার করে ফ্রন্টএন্ড তৈরি
করা হয়। একজন ফ্রন্টএন্ড ডেভেলপার ডিজাইনারদের তৈরি করা মকআপগুলোকে কোডের মাধ্যমে
জীবন্ত করে তোলেন।
২. ব্যাকএন্ড ডেভেলপমেন্টঃ
ব্যাকএন্ড হলো ওয়েবসাইটের অদৃশ্য অংশ, যা সার্ভার এবং ডাটাবেসের সঙ্গে কাজ করে।
এটি ব্যবহারকারীর ইনপুট প্রসেসিং করে এবং প্রয়োজনীয় ডাটা সরবরাহ করে। PHP,
Python, Node.js, এবং Django এর মতো প্রযুক্তি ব্যাকএন্ডে ব্যবহৃত হয়।
৩. ফুলস্ট্যাক ডেভেলপমেন্টঃ
যারা ফ্রন্টএন্ড এবং ব্যাকএন্ড উভয় অংশেই দক্ষ, তাদের বলা হয় ফুলস্ট্যাক
ডেভেলপার। ফুলস্ট্যাক ডেভেলপারদের কাজের সুযোগ অনেক বেশি, কারণ তারা একটি
প্রজেক্টের পুরো উন্নয়ন প্রক্রিয়া পরিচালনা করতে পারে।
১. সৃজনশীলতা এবং সমস্যার সমাধান করার সুযোগঃ
ওয়েব ডেভেলপমেন্টে কাজ করতে গেলে প্রতিদিন নতুন কিছু শেখার সুযোগ থাকে এবং
সৃজনশীলতার মাধ্যমে সমস্যার সমাধান করা যায়। ফ্রন্টএন্ডে কাজ করার সময়
ব্যবহারকারীর অভিজ্ঞতা উন্নত করার জন্য বিভিন্ন ডিজাইন এবং ইন্টারঅ্যাকটিভ উপাদান
তৈরি করা হয়। অন্যদিকে, ব্যাকএন্ডে জটিল সমস্যার সমাধান করতে হয়, যেমন দ্রুত
সার্ভার রেসপন্স বা ডাটাবেস ম্যানেজমেন্ট।
২. বৈশ্বিক চাহিদা এবং কাজের সুযোগঃ
বর্তমান যুগে প্রায় প্রতিটি ব্যবসা অনলাইন প্ল্যাটফর্মে আসতে চায়, যার ফলে
ওয়েবসাইট এবং ওয়েব অ্যাপ্লিকেশন ডেভেলপারদের চাহিদা দ্রুত বাড়ছে। বিশেষ করে
ফ্রিল্যান্সিং প্ল্যাটফর্মগুলো, যেমন Upwork, Fiverr, এবং Freelancer-এ ওয়েব
ডেভেলপমেন্ট প্রজেক্টের সংখ্যা অন্যান্য সেক্টরের তুলনায় বেশি।
৩. স্বাধীনতা এবং কাজের সময়ের নিয়ন্ত্রণঃ
ফ্রিল্যান্সিংয়ের সবচেয়ে বড় সুবিধা হলো স্বাধীনতা। একজন ওয়েব ডেভেলপার নিজের
ইচ্ছেমতো প্রজেক্ট বেছে নিতে পারে এবং সময় নির্ধারণ করতে পারে। আমার জন্য এই
স্বাধীনতা অত্যন্ত গুরুত্বপূর্ণ, কারণ এতে ব্যক্তিগত এবং পেশাগত জীবনের মধ্যে
ভারসাম্য রাখা সহজ হয়।
৪. অর্থনৈতিক দিক থেকে লাভজনকঃ
ওয়েব ডেভেলপমেন্টে দক্ষতা অর্জন করলে অর্থ উপার্জনের অনেক সুযোগ থাকে। ছোটখাটো
ওয়েবসাইট তৈরি থেকে শুরু করে ই-কমার্স সাইট বা কাস্টম ওয়েব অ্যাপ্লিকেশন তৈরির
মতো কাজের জন্য বড় অঙ্কের পারিশ্রমিক পাওয়া যায়। এমনকি, দক্ষতার সঙ্গে নির্দিষ্ট
একটি নিচ বা প্রযুক্তিতে বিশেষায়িত হলে আয় আরও বেড়ে যায়।
৫. প্রযুক্তিগত জ্ঞানের উন্নয়নঃ
ওয়েব ডেভেলপমেন্টের জগৎটি প্রতিনিয়ত পরিবর্তিত হচ্ছে। নতুন নতুন ফ্রেমওয়ার্ক,
লাইব্রেরি এবং টুলের সঙ্গে পরিচিত হতে হয়। এই পরিবর্তনশীল পরিবেশ আমাকে সবসময়
শিখতে এবং নিজেকে উন্নত করতে উদ্বুদ্ধ করে, যা আমার জন্য অন্যতম আকর্ষণ।
১. মৌলিক স্কিল অর্জনঃ ওয়েব ডেভেলপমেন্ট শুরু করতে চাইলে HTML, CSS, এবং
JavaScript এর মতো বেসিক ভাষাগুলো শেখা জরুরি। এগুলো ফ্রন্টএন্ডের জন্য
গুরুত্বপূর্ণ। ব্যাকএন্ডের জন্য Python, PHP, বা Node.js-এর মতো প্রযুক্তি বেছে
নেওয়া যেতে পারে।
২. অনলাইন কোর্স এবং রিসোর্স ব্যবহারঃ অনলাইন প্ল্যাটফর্ম যেমন Coursera,
Udemy, এবং Codecademy থেকে ওয়েব ডেভেলপমেন্ট শেখা যায়। এ ছাড়া YouTube এবং
ফোরামগুলোতেও প্রচুর বিনামূল্যের রিসোর্স পাওয়া যায়।
৩. প্র্যাকটিস এবং পোর্টফোলিও তৈরিঃ শুধু শিখলেই হবে না, বরং নিয়মিত
প্র্যাকটিস করে নিজের দক্ষতা বাড়াতে হবে। ছোট ছোট প্রজেক্ট তৈরি করে পোর্টফোলিওতে
যুক্ত করা খুবই জরুরি, কারণ ক্লায়েন্টরা মূলত কাজের নমুনা দেখে সিদ্ধান্ত নেয়।
৪. ফ্রিল্যান্সিং প্ল্যাটফর্মে প্রোফাইল তৈরিঃ Fiverr, Upwork,
Toptal, এবং Freelancer-এর মতো জনপ্রিয় ফ্রিল্যান্সিং প্ল্যাটফর্মে প্রোফাইল তৈরি
করে কাজ খোঁজা শুরু করা যায়। ভালো রেটিং এবং রিভিউ পেলে ভবিষ্যতে আরও ভালো
প্রজেক্ট পাওয়ার সম্ভাবনা বাড়ে।
৫. নেটওয়ার্কিং এবং কাস্টমার রিলেশন ম্যানেজমেন্টঃ ফ্রিল্যান্সিং
ক্যারিয়ারে সফল হতে চাইলে শুধু দক্ষতা থাকাই যথেষ্ট নয়; ক্লায়েন্টদের সঙ্গে ভালো
সম্পর্ক গড়ে তোলাও জরুরি। নিয়মিত যোগাযোগ এবং কাজের সময়মতো ডেলিভারি বিশ্বস্ততা
তৈরি করে।
১. প্রতিযোগিতা বেশিঃ ফ্রিল্যান্সিং প্ল্যাটফর্মগুলোতে প্রতিযোগিতা খুব
বেশি, বিশেষ করে নতুনদের জন্য কাজ পাওয়া কঠিন হতে পারে। এর সমাধান হলো নির্দিষ্ট
একটি নিচে দক্ষতা অর্জন করে স্পেশালাইজড প্রোফাইল তৈরি করা।
২. নিয়মিত আপডেট থাকার প্রয়োজনঃ প্রযুক্তি দ্রুত পরিবর্তনশীল, তাই ওয়েব
ডেভেলপারদের সবসময় নতুন টুল এবং ফ্রেমওয়ার্ক সম্পর্কে আপডেট থাকতে হয়। নতুন স্কিল
শেখার জন্য সময় বরাদ্দ করাই এর সমাধান।
৩. সময়ের সঠিক ব্যবস্থাপনাঃ ফ্রিল্যান্সিংয়ে কাজের সময় নিজে ঠিক করতে
হয়, তাই সঠিক সময় ব্যবস্থাপনা করা অনেক সময় কঠিন হয়ে পড়ে। টাস্ক ম্যানেজমেন্ট
টুল, যেমন Trello বা Asana ব্যবহার করে কাজের অগ্রগতি ট্র্যাক করা যায়।
ওয়েব ডেভেলপমেন্ট সেক্টরটি আমার জন্য সবচেয়ে পছন্দনীয় কারণ এটি সৃজনশীলতা,
প্রযুক্তিগত দক্ষতা এবং সমস্যার সমাধান করার সুযোগ প্রদান করে। ফ্রিল্যান্সার
হিসেবে এই সেক্টরে কাজ করলে স্বাধীনভাবে কাজ করার সুযোগ মেলে, যা আমার জন্য
অত্যন্ত গুরুত্বপূর্ণ। ওয়েব ডেভেলপমেন্টে ক্যারিয়ার গঠন করলে শুধু আর্থিকভাবে
স্বাবলম্বী হওয়া যায় না, বরং প্রযুক্তিগতভাবে দক্ষ একজন পেশাজীবী হিসেবেও নিজেকে
প্রতিষ্ঠিত করা যায়। এ কারণে, ফ্রিল্যান্সিং জগতে আমি এই সেক্টরকেই বেছে নিয়েছি
এবং ভবিষ্যতে এই ক্ষেত্রেই নিজেকে আরও উন্নত করতে চাই।
এই আর্টিকেলটি ওয়েব ডেভেলপমেন্টের প্রতি আমার আগ্রহ এবং এই সেক্টরের সম্ভাবনাগুলো
তুলে ধরেছে। আশা করি, যারা ফ্রিল্যান্সিং ক্যারিয়ার শুরু করতে চান, তাদের জন্য
এটি উপকারী হবে।
কিনলে আইটির নীতিমালা মেনে কমেন্ট করুন। প্রতিটি কমেন্ট রিভিউ করা হয়।
comment url